From 91cf20e521c7d8d9b290e9ac01b143fb525ae086 Mon Sep 17 00:00:00 2001 From: jacob1 Date: Thu, 1 Oct 2015 22:55:32 -0400 Subject: [PATCH] prevent tool buttons from being longer than 7 characters for i=1,250 do elements.property(i,"Name",(("ALL BASE BELONG TO US "):rep(20)..(" "):rep(120)..string.char(10)):rep(70)) end Could prevent it from lua, but too much work for no reason. Still allows SPWN2 button to work. --- src/gui/game/ToolButton.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/gui/game/ToolButton.cpp b/src/gui/game/ToolButton.cpp index 238c6d479..202b77933 100644 --- a/src/gui/game/ToolButton.cpp +++ b/src/gui/game/ToolButton.cpp @@ -8,7 +8,7 @@ ToolButton::ToolButton(ui::Point position, ui::Point size, std::string text_, st Appearance.BorderActive = ui::Colour(255, 0, 0); //don't use "..." on elements that have long names - buttonDisplayText = ButtonText; + buttonDisplayText = ButtonText.substr(0, 7); Component::TextPosition(buttonDisplayText); }